Octadecapeptide
noun
noun 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 A polypeptide containing eighteen amino acid moieties
"Even though it has not been tested yet on specific models of AD, apamin, a stable octadecapeptide isolated from bee Apis mellifera, has been proven an important tool in learning and memory studies as it is considered a blocker of small conductance calcium-activated K + channels in the CNS."

Etymology
From octadeca- + peptide.
